Subject: [PATCH 06/15] fpga: dfl: fme: add DFL_FPGA_FME_PORT_RELEASE/ASSIGN ioctl support.
Date: Thu, 27 Jun 2019 17:49:42 -0700	[thread overview]
Message-ID: <20190628004951.6202-7-mdf@kernel.org> (raw)
In-Reply-To: <20190628004951.6202-1-mdf@kernel.org>

From: Wu Hao <hao.wu@intel.com>

In order to support virtualization usage via PCIe SRIOV, this patch
adds two ioctls under FPGA Management Engine (FME) to release and
assign back the port device. In order to safely turn Port from PF
into VF and enable PCIe SRIOV, it requires user to invoke this
PORT_RELEASE ioctl to release port firstly to remove userspace
interfaces, and then configure the PF/VF access register in FME.
After disable SRIOV, it requires user to invoke this PORT_ASSIGN
ioctl to attach the port back to PF.

 Ioctl interfaces:
 * DFL_FPGA_FME_PORT_RELEASE
   Release platform device of given port, it deletes port platform
   device to remove related userspace interfaces on PF, then
   configures PF/VF access mode to VF.

 * DFL_FPGA_FME_PORT_ASSIGN
   Assign platform device of given port back to PF, it configures
   PF/VF access mode to PF, then adds port platform device back to
   re-enable related userspace interfaces on PF.

diff --git a/include/uapi/linux/fpga-dfl.h b/include/uapi/linux/fpga-dfl.h
index 2e324e515c41..e9a00e014114 100644
--- a/include/uapi/linux/fpga-dfl.h
+++ b/include/uapi/linux/fpga-dfl.h
@@ -176,4 +176,36 @@ struct dfl_fpga_fme_port_pr {
 
 #define DFL_FPGA_FME_PORT_PR	_IO(DFL_FPGA_MAGIC, DFL_FME_BASE + 0)
 
+/**
+ * DFL_FPGA_FME_PORT_RELEASE - _IOW(DFL_FPGA_MAGIC, DFL_FME_BASE + 1,
+ *					struct dfl_fpga_fme_port_release)
+ *
+ * Driver releases the port per Port ID provided by caller.
+ * Return: 0 on success, -errno on failure.
+ */
+struct dfl_fpga_fme_port_release {
+	/* Input */
+	__u32 argsz;		/* Structure length */
+	__u32 flags;		/* Zero for now */
+	__u32 port_id;
+};
+
+#define DFL_FPGA_FME_PORT_RELEASE	_IO(DFL_FPGA_MAGIC, DFL_FME_BASE + 1)
+
+/**
+ * DFL_FPGA_FME_PORT_ASSIGN - _IOW(DFL_FPGA_MAGIC, DFL_FME_BASE + 2,
+ *					struct dfl_fpga_fme_port_assign)
+ *
+ * Driver assigns the port back per Port ID provided by caller.
+ * Return: 0 on success, -errno on failure.
+ */
+struct dfl_fpga_fme_port_assign {
+	/* Input */
+	__u32 argsz;		/* Structure length */
+	__u32 flags;		/* Zero for now */
+	__u32 port_id;
+};
+
+#define DFL_FPGA_FME_PORT_ASSIGN	_IO(DFL_FPGA_MAGIC, DFL_FME_BASE + 2)
+
 #endif /* _UAPI_LINUX_FPGA_DFL_H */
